We are/are not. Oregon State Law prohibits all animals in all restaurants, unless it is a service animal. A service animal being a trained working animal, not a pet. The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) defines a service animal as a dog that is individually trained to do work or perform tasks for a person with a disability. Dogs or therapy animals whose function is to provide comfort or emotional support do not qualify as service animals according to the ADA, even with a doctor’s note.
